20 Prisencolinensinainciusol

Sticking with the musical theme, "Prisencolinensinainciusol" is a song that was originally written in 1972 by Adriano Celentano, an Italian TV host. The lyrics are complete gibberish - although they sort of sound like a Tourettes-afflicted Bob Dylan, they mean nothing in Italian or English. And yet - and yet it rocks so hard.

16 Cyriak's Animation Mix

British animator Cyriak Harris is a man with a very strange brain. His unique and bizarre Web animations, set to soundtracks of his own devising, are quick little peeks into a world of surreal hilarity. This megamix of literally dozens of his best will keep you glued to the screen for five minutes.

 1 Tunak Tunak Tun

The video for "Tunak Tunak Tun" by Daler Mehndi has been floating around on the Internet since before YouTube even existed. I first saw it in like 1998. Thirteen years later, it's still one of the greatest thing ever. Over a ridiculously catchy beat, the Punjabi singer (with the aid of some special effects) drops flow like whoa.
